Edge’s webiste has posted the big feature on the game that formed the cornerstone of the mag’s latest issue, which gives us our first real details on how the game is going to be worked into the existing EVE experience. CCP’s creative director, Atli Mar Sveinsson, explains how the game’s multiplayer combat is a little different. “You’re given some interesting choices before the fighting’s even started. There are ten vehicle classes, but the commander can only commit five for each battle. We have 15 installation types, and he can only choose five. It’s simple, really, like Magic: The Gathering: you prepare your deck and then fight.”
The most ambitious element is the Eve link,” he says. “The other stuff has been proven in other games. Running around with a gun is a proven concept: let’s just make it really good. It’s when Eve comes in that it becomes special. We’re sharing the universe: your basic interface to the world in Dust is even through the same star-map as Eve.”
